2008/4/22, Igor Stasenko <siguctua@...>:
> okay, i figured it out by implementing a #charSet method in my session
>  subclass to return iso charset instead of utf-8.

That sounds more like a hack until the problem gives up rather than a
fix. Could you answer:
- what encoding your web page should have
- what encoding the strings in your image should have

Since you are dealing with Squeak literals, it might be better to use
WAKomEncoded and utf-8 in the web and Squeak encoding in your image.
